GLX-351322 is an inhibitor of NADPH oxidase 4 (NOX4; IC50 = 5 µM). It is selective for NOX4 over NOX2 (IC50 = 40 µM). GLX-351322 (10 µM) reduces glucose-induced production of reactive oxygen species (ROS) and cytotoxicity in isolated human pancreatic islets. It decreases blood glucose levels in an intravenous glucose tolerance test in mice fed a high-fat diet when administered in the drinking water at an estimated dose of 3.8 mg/kg per day.
